Hello,

in my new game (Scen 2) i noticed that sometimes destroyed troops you bought back, automaticly disperse at the end of the arrival turn (disperse happends before supply distribution or a bug in supply distribution?). Happend two times now (in Aden and Auckland) for me, but it doesn't happens always. Reloading the pre-turn save and running the turn again always "saved" the units.

I think it is about the 'size' of the unit being rebuilt. Normally units of size '0' will disband. Maybe the rebuilt unit has only a support device or something of little value that is driving this.
Did the unit only have a support device in it? That is usually the default device if nothing else is rebuilt in the unit.
